Structural repair services involve assessing and fixing issues related to the foundational elements of a property. These services typically include identifying problems such as cracks in walls, uneven flooring, or settling foundations, and then implementing solutions to stabilize and reinforce the structure.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ques and materials to ensure that the building remains safe, level, and durable over time. Addressing structural concerns early can prevent more extensive damage and costly repairs in the future.

Many property problems stem from underlying structural issues that compromise the integrity of a building. Common signs include visible cracks in walls or ceilings, doors and windows that no longer close properly, or noticeable shifts in the property’s shape. These issues often result from soil movement, moisture intrusion, or aging materials. Structural repair services help resolve these problems by restoring stability, preventing further deterioration, and preserving the property's value and safety.

Structural repair services are applicable to a variety of property types, including residential homes, multi-family buildings, and commercial properties. Homeowners may seek repairs after experiencing foundation settlement or damage from natural events like heavy rains or shifting soil. Property owners of older buildings might need reinforcement to meet current safety standards or to address wear and tear. These services are essential whenever structural elements show signs of stress or damage that could threaten the stability and safety of the property.

The overview below groups typical Structural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Burlington, KY.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or structural repairs, such as fixing small cracks or localized damage,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Moderate Projects - Medium-scale repairs, including partial foundation stabilization or wall reinforcement, often c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common and represent a significant portion of local repair work.

Major Repairs - Larger, more complex structural fixes, like extensive foundation repairs or major wall rebuilds, can range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ically involving significant structural concerns or extensive labor.

Full Replacement - Complete foundation or structural component replacements tend to start around $15,000 and can exceed $50,000 for very large or intricate projects. Such jobs are less frequent but necessary for severe damage or aging structures.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of structural repairs do local contractors handle? Local contractors can address a variety of structural issues including foundation cracks, settling, wall bowing, and support beam damage to help stabilize and restore buildings.

How can I tell if my property needs structural repair services? Signs such as u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ible foundation shifts may indicate the need for professional structural assessment and repairs.

What should I consider when choosing a structural repair service provider? It’s important to look for experienced local service providers with good reputations, who can evaluate your property’s needs and recommend appropriate repair solutions.

Are structural repairs safe for my property? Properly performed structural repairs by qualified local contractors aim to restore stability and safety, reducing the risk of further damage or structural failure.

What types of materials are used in structural repair work? Common materials include steel supports, carbon fiber reinforcement, concrete, and epoxy injections, selected based on the specific repair needs of the property.
